i dont know how to improve anymore, i feel like ive stagnated and any drawing or painting i make feels like reinforcing what i know already instead of making me grow. where should i go from here?

pic rel is where im currently at

Move outside of your comfort zones. You probably feel stagnat because you're doing the same stuff over and over and you're bored.

Can you paint action sequences? Can you set up scenes in multiple perspectives? Can you paint machinery? Weapons? Two characters interacting? What about five? Can you paint an interesting landscape or urban environment? Can you tell a story with your pictures?

Get creative, there's a lot of shite to learn and a lot of ways to push yourself.

You're thinking too linearly about how progress works. You have to push outside of what you're already comfortable with by applying what you've learned to more and more difficult tasks. The logic of learning simple things is fine, but you need to apply those things to more complex work in order to grow out of it; you learn a lot more in the application than you would trying to perfect things in a vacuum.

If you feel you've stagnated you could try and carry something to a full finish. Everything you've posted is fine as quick studies or sketches but it's severely lacking polish and appeal. Everything is very messy. Go on, try and make something as appealing as you can.
